Product information
The Laney Super-Cube Top is an all-tube guitar head with two inputs: one input for a power of 15 watts and a second input for a power of > 1 watt. This means that the compact amp can be driven to full tube saturation even at low volumes. The rich sound can be adjusted using a 3-band EQ and a tone controls . The Laney Super-Cube Top also has a serial effect loop and an adjustable reverb. Laney Super Cub Top:
  • Channels: 1
  • Country of origin: England
  • Dimensions (WxHxD): 430x176x210mm
  • EQ: Boost, gain, Bass, Middle, Treble, reverb, Volume
  • Effects: Reverb/ reverb
  • Gain levels: 1
  • Housing size: Full size
  • Impedance: 8/16 ohms
  • Inserts: Serial
  • Power: 15W
  • Power amp valves: 2x EL84
  • Power range: 0 - 15W
  • Pre amp valves: 3x 12AX7
  • Special features: Boost
  • Technology: Tube
  • Weight: 7.5kg
About Laney

Laney - first of all, that's official tube sound made in England. Since Lyndon Laney founded his company in Birmingham almost 50 years ago, the company has made a name for itself worldwide in guitar and bass amplifiers, speakers and PA systems. The all-tube guitar and bass amps in particular enjoy an excellent reputation, especially in the hard'n'heavy sector. So it's no surprise that users include well-known artists such as Tony Iommi (Black Sabbath), who also has his own signature amp, Ace Frehley (KISS), Mattias Eklundh and Kiko Loureiro (Angra). Lately Laney has been making a name for himself with his innovative Ironheart and Lionheart amps, but the little Cubs and acoustic amps are also absolutely worth playing.
